> ABOUT *Active Radio*:
>
> This issue is guest edited by Dr. Owen Chapman, from the department of
> Communication Studies, Concordia University, and focuses on the role and
> place of "Active Radio".* * The concept of active radio comes from Jean
> Laurendeau's french-language biography of Maurice Martenot--inventor of les
> Ondes Martenot. This early electronic musical instrument (1928) produces its
> sound through the interaction of two radio waves. "Active radio" disrupts
> the passive way we often consider radio technology--as a form of mass media,
> with most of us on the receiving end of radiophonic broadcasts.We are
> pleased to bring you an issue that engages with and questions the
> relationship between radio and mobile practices.
